My tack line has a shackle on the "business" end, it then runs through a block that is shackled to the front hole in the stemhead fitting, then it runs across the cabin top to a jammer on the port side. It's long enough to accommodate sets/take downs.

The two sheets run back to blocks that are shackled to pad eyes on deck just forward of the front feet of the stern pulpit.

The halyard runs back to a jammer on the cabin top.

To douse, I blow the tack, grab the sheet to start bringing in, then quick release about a third of the halyard so someone can gather...

Works pretty well so far...

I need to work a bit on jibing, but that'll take time.
